Berkeley School of Theology (BST), founded in 1871 in Berkeley, California, is a graduate theological seminary affiliated with the American Baptist Churches USA. Specializing in divinity and ministry programs, BST prepares students for pastoral and academic careers. The seminary shares a campus with the Graduate Theological Union, offering access to interdenominational resources and libraries.
BST's location in the San Francisco Bay Area provides opportunities for interfaith dialogue and social justice work. The seminary emphasizes contextual learning, with students engaging in urban and global ministry. BST's small class sizes and ecumenical partnerships foster a collaborative, intellectually rigorous environment for theological education.
